
Engineering Intern Job Locations US-OH-Fairfield ID 2026-19716 Overview Element has an opportunity for an Engineering Intern to join our Cincinnati team. This is a great opportunity to develop your skills within a Global TIC business and learn how we impact the Aerospace industry.
Salary: $20- $25/hr DOE Responsibilities Essential duty is to support daily activities for all Aerospace departments Fatigue data input: Analyze LCF data, Lims data entry, and frame input Fatigue crack growth measurements – perform and develop improved process Run machining and testing equipment Project management/coordination Client communication Review and update current processes and equipment Develop new testing methods Excel template validation/creation Develop and maintain training manuals and TPM information Performing general duties in accordance with Element's internal procedures, quality as well as Health and Safety system Skills / Qualifications Enrolled in Aerospace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Industrial and Systems Engineering, or Materials Engineering college courses Hands-on job Sound mechanical bias Self-motivated with the ability to multitask, organize and work under the pressure of a busy commercial mechanical test laboratory Excellent attention to detail Strong written and verbal communication skills A team player attitude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ills Company Overview Element is one of the fastest growing testing, inspection and certification businesses in the world.
